The JET 321301 is a heavy-duty gap-bed engine lathe paired with an ACU-RITE 300S digital readout (DRO) system, designed for precision turning operations in industrial and professional machine shop environments. Weighing 5,350 pounds, this unit is a substantial floor-standing machine intended for high-accuracy metal turning, facing, threading, and boring work. The integrated ACU-RITE 300S DRO provides real-time axis position feedback, reducing setup time and improving repeatability across production runs. Installation and commissioning are typically performed by qualified millwrights or machine tool technicians.
The GH-1440ZX configuration is suited for professional machine shops, toolrooms, vocational training facilities, and industrial maintenance departments requiring a full-featured engine lathe with built-in digital readout capability. The ACU-RITE 300S DRO is factory-integrated, making this a ready-to-run package without the need for a separate DRO retrofit. Typical applications include precision shaft turning, threading, and general-purpose metal removal in both job-shop and production environments.

Installation of a machine tool of this size and weight requires a qualified millwright or machine tool technician and appropriate lifting equipment rated for at least 5,350 pounds. The lathe must be mounted on a level, reinforced concrete floor and properly anchored before operation. All electrical connections should be made by a licensed electrician in accordance with applicable NEC requirements for the voltage and phase configuration of the unit. Power must be fully locked out and tagged out before performing any service, tooling changes, or adjustments to the machine.
